Output 69d24fd9de7a6c551030ff961e7683fe1b4d1a3c65e35e684ecd54ec95f0e958:14

value
44426153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aff3d2c1f07529097c8557913d4edcf872a6805e OP_EQUALVERIFY OP_CHECKSIG
address
1H3MLi5Y3WeCaVqHoekqWgaU1aNy8u6ZMK
transaction
69d24fd9de7a6c551030ff961e7683fe1b4d1a3c65e35e684ecd54ec95f0e958
confirmations
532225
spent
true